Site Health and Safety Plan <br />Countryside Market, Stockton, California March 21, 2014 <br />5.0 AIR MONITORING <br />Whenever work is performed that might generate gases, organic vapors, dusts, fumes, mists, or <br />other airborne hazardous materials, air monitoring will be conducted. Breathing zone air <br />monitoring will be conducted periodically throughout the day while work is being performed under <br />above conditions, and results will be documented (see Appendix H). The following instruments <br />may be used to monitor air quality: <br />Photoionization Detector (PID) — It will be used to detect trace concentrations of certain <br />organic gases and a few inorganic gases in the air. The PID detects mixtures of <br />compounds simultaneously. PID readings do not measure concentrations of any individual <br />compound when a mixture of compounds is present. The PID will serve as the primary <br />instrument for personnel exposure monitoring. The breathing zone will be monitored at <br />least two times per hour. <br />Colorimetric Tubes - If the PID readings indicate the potential for exposures exceeding <br />actions levels, hand pumps with chemical-specific colorimetric tubes will be used. In <br />general, at a site suspected to contain volatile organic compounds, chemical-specific <br />calorimetric tubes should be available for site-related VOCs (e.g., benzene, trichloroethene, <br />tetrachloroethene, vinyl chloride). <br />Combustible Gas Indicator/Oxygen — During operations involving known combustible <br />materials (e.g., free product) or operations conducted in an oxygen deficient environment <br />(e.g., confined space), an approved Combustible Gas Indicator/Oxygen Meter and/or a four <br />gas meter will be used to measure the concentration of flammable vapors and gases and <br />oxygen in the air during field activities. Flammable gas concentrations are measured as <br />percentages of the Lower Explosive Limit (LEL). Oxygen content is measured as a <br />percentage of air. <br />All equipment should be calibrated and maintained in accordance with the Equipment Calibration <br />and Maintenance table in Appendix H. All air monitoring should be logged on the Air Monitoring <br />Log in Appendix H. <br />Table 3 presents the action levels for air quality monitoring.
